This stitch is the last of the chain arch stitch varieties. It is a balanced stitch that would not need any other adornments to be complete.
Next we will continue to work with half-circle bases…but will use a simple wrapped straight stitch as our method to construct the base instead of the chain stitch. However, any base can still be done with the chain if you desire.
